Milwaukee county voters could vote on Co. Supervisor pay under proposed bill

MIlWAUKEE, WI (WTAQ) - Legislation being fast-tracked at the Capitol would let Milwaukee County voters decide next April whether they want to cut county supervisors’ pay from $50,000 a year to $15,000.

It would also strip about five million dollars from the county budget, severely impacting the boards ability to function as the county’s legislative branch of government.

Opponents of the measure say it would hurt diversity on the board, leave low-income neighborhoods unrepresented and shift the governing power to County Executive Chris Abele.
